Wednesday, October 24, 2007

Time Off

The Rockies had eight days off between the NLCS and tonight's Game 1 -- the longest such break in history. Game 1 starter Jeff Francis however, hasn't pitched in 12 days.

On the Roster

Aaron Cook, who hasn't pitched for the Rockies since Aug. 10, will start Game 4.

Off the Roster

Tim Wakefield, who won 17 games for the Red Sox during the regular season, was removed from the roster because of injury.

Unbeatable Beckett

Boston's Game 1 starter Josh Beckett is 3-0 with a 1.17 ERA this postseason.
